NEW ROCHELLE, NY - Marist rallied from a three-point, 12-9, deficit in the fifth and deciding set to defeat the Iona College Volleyball team 3-2 in Metro Atlantic Athletic Conference action at the Hynes Center. The Red Foxes defeated the Gaels with set scores 25-19, 15-25, 27-25, 19-25 and 15-13.
Sophomore MB
Catrina Warren led all performers with 19 kills and a .341 hitting percentage. She recorded six digs and four blocks in the loss. Junior OH
Alicja Pawelec posted a double double with 14 kils and 19 digs. Her classmate
Madisyn Spence also posted a double-double with 12 kills and 15 digs.
Sophomore S
Caris Myles was the third Gael with double-digits in two statistical categories with 31 assists and 11 digs. She played in the first three sets of the match. Rookie S
Natalie Ziskin came on in the fourth and recorded 12 assists in two sets.
Marist was led by a quartet of hitters with nine or more kills. Katie Estes (15), Kelsey Lahey (14), Mackenzie Stephens (12) and Courtney Shaw (9) were responsible for 50 of the visitor's 60 kills. Libero Brooke Zywick had 36 digs while S Audra Brady had 48 assists, 14 digs, five blocks and three kills.
The first two sets proved one sided for each team. In the first, Marist took the lead for good after snapping a 5-5 tie, the only tie of the frame and won 25-19. Iona led wire-to-wire in set two, using a 12-5 run to end it after the Red Foxes pulled to within three.
The third set was the tightest of the five featuring nine ties and five lead changes. After Marist reached its first set point at 24-22, Iona rallied to knot the score at 24 with kills by Myles and Warren. The Red Foxes finally took the two-point advanage it needed to win the frame on their fourth set point on an Iona hitting error.
The fourth was all Iona again as they opened up an early 6-1 advantage and never looked back. Marist got to within two points at 18-16 but Iona closed out the set with seven of the final 10 points.
The Gaels started off strong in the decider, opening a 6-2 advantage. After a Red Fox time out, the visitors scored three straight points to close the margin to one. With the score tied at 7-7, Iona ran off three straight points to take command. Facing the 12-9 deficit, Marist rallied to tie at 13-13 and scored and continued a 4-0 run to end the match.
